Self-Scoring IQ Tests by Victor Serebriakoff
Honorary International President of MENSA Victor Serebriakoff has created two comprehensive tests--similar to the elaborate standardized ones administered by professional psychologists--perfectly designed to measure your cognitive skills, reasoning abilities, quick-learning capability, and problem-solving proficiency. Begin with the practice quizzes to warm up, and then proceed to the actual tests, which concentrate on verbal, mathematical, and spatial relations questions. At the end of the booklet, you'll find the right answers and an explanation of how to determine your IQ from your scores.
